远程桌面无法连接Oracle数据库解决
远程桌面连接oracle没有

首页 2024-11-02 06:36:08



远程桌面连接Oracle数据库缺失的解决方案与重要性探讨 在当今数字化时代,企业对于高效、安全的数据管理需求日益增长

    Oracle数据库,作为业界领先的数据库管理系统,凭借其强大的数据处理能力、高可用性和安全性,成为众多企业的首选

    然而,在实际应用中,有时会遇到一个棘手的问题:无法通过远程桌面连接Oracle数据库

    这一问题不仅影响了工作效率,还可能对业务连续性构成威胁

    本文旨在深入探讨这一问题,并提出有效的解决方案,同时强调远程访问Oracle数据库的重要性

     一、远程桌面连接Oracle数据库的重要性 远程桌面连接Oracle数据库,意味着无论身处何地,只要有网络连接,数据库管理员或授权用户都能随时访问和操作数据库

    这对于跨地域办公、紧急故障排除、数据分析与报告生成等场景至关重要

    它不仅提高了工作效率,还促进了团队协作,使得企业能够更灵活地应对市场变化

     1.提高响应速度:远程访问允许快速响应业务需求,减少因地理位置限制导致的延迟

     2.增强团队协作:团队成员无论身在何处,都能实时共享数据,协同工作

     3.优化资源利用:集中管理数据库资源,避免重复建设和资源浪费

     4.保障业务连续性:在灾难恢复或业务迁移时,远程访问能力能确保业务不受影响

     二、远程桌面连接Oracle数据库缺失的原因分析 当遇到无法远程连接Oracle数据库的情况时,可能的原因包括但不限于以下几点: 1.网络配置问题:防火墙设置、路由器配置或网络策略可能阻止了远程访问

     2.Oracle监听器配置错误:监听器未正确配置或未启动,导致无法接收远程连接请求

     3.用户权限问题:远程用户可能没有足够的权限访问数据库

     4.客户端配置不当:远程桌面客户端或Oracle客户端工具配置错误

     5.版本兼容性问题:客户端与服务器端的Oracle版本不兼容

     三、解决方案与步骤 针对上述问题,以下是一些有效的解决方案及实施步骤: 1.检查网络配置: - 确认防火墙规则允许Oracle服务的端口(默认1521)通过

     - 检查路由器NAT配置,确保外部IP正确映射到内部服务器

     - 确认网络策略未限制远程访问

     2.配置Oracle监听器: -使用`lsnrctl status`检查监听器状态,确保其正在运行

     -查看`listener.ora`文件,确认监听器配置正确,包括服务名、端口等

     - 如有必要,重启监听器服务

     3.调整用户权限: - 确保远程用户具有适当的数据库访问权限

     - 使用DBA权限登录,检查并修改用户权限设置

     4.配置客户端: - 确保远程桌面客户端软件支持Oracle数据库连接

     - 在客户端上正确配置Oracle客户端工具,如Oracle SQL Developer或SQLPlus

     - 测试网络连接,确保客户端能访问Oracle服务器

     5.检查版本兼容性: - 确认客户端与服务器的Oracle版本是否兼容

     - 如不兼容,考虑升级客户端或服务器端的Oracle软件

     四、结论 远程桌面连接Oracle数据库的能力对于企业的日常运营至关重要

    面对连接失败的问题,通过系统地检查网络配置、监听器设置、用户权限、客户端配置以及版本兼容性,可以有效定位并解决问题

    企业应重视并优化远程访